367 Items

Current filters

$303.66
$404.88
$25.30
$25.30
$25.30
$25.30
$40.49
$40.49
$40.49
$40.49
$40.49
$40.49
$40.49
$40.49
$40.49
$506.10
$506.10
$506.10
$45.55
$45.55
$35.43

The Road To Furoshiki